Sen. Samuel D. Brownback

|
Nickname: known as "Sam"
Birthdate: b. 09/12/1956
Birthplace: Parker, KS
Political Party: Republican
Religion: Roman Catholic
Education: JD, University of Kansas, 1982
BS, Agricultural Economics, Kansas State University, 1979.
Last elected in 2004 receiving 780,863 (69.0%) votes.
